Transaction 4333b25cce83b3acbb3ad79d58b2fa6b721ff9dec887873bb4be6f2007043122
1 Input
1 Output
-
4333b25cce83b3acbb3ad79d58b2fa6b721ff9dec887873bb4be6f2007043122:0
- value
- 502800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9000768d3b344d1ed35ca26764eda4200655cc7e OP_EQUAL
- address
- 3EpRnLt1bpP7tXZJNeTYELmDza7Xsspuqr